Management of Renal Artery Pseudoaneurysm in a Smoker
Immediate Smoking Cessation is Mandatory
All smokers with renal artery pseudoaneurysm must be counseled to stop smoking immediately, as smoking accelerates aneurysm formation, growth, and rupture risk. 1
- Smoking is the single largest modifiable risk factor for aneurysm development and progression across all vascular territories 1
- Use the 5 A's approach (Ask, Advise, Assess, Assist, Arrange) combined with pharmacotherapy: nicotine replacement, bupropion, or varenicline 1
- While e-cigarettes may aid cessation, their safety in patients with vascular aneurysms remains unproven due to adverse vascular remodeling effects 1
Definitive Treatment Algorithm
Step 1: Confirm Diagnosis with Imaging
Obtain CT angiography or selective renal angiography immediately to confirm the pseudoaneurysm, measure its size, assess for active bleeding, and evaluate the feeding vessel anatomy 2, 3, 4
- Physical examination alone is unreliable and misses the majority of vascular lesions 5
- Duplex ultrasound showing "to-and-fro" flow can confirm the diagnosis but CT angiography provides superior anatomic detail for treatment planning 5, 2
Step 2: Risk Stratification and Treatment Selection
Immediate Endovascular Intervention (First-Line)
Selective angiographic coil embolization is the definitive treatment for renal artery pseudoaneurysm and should be performed urgently 2, 3, 4, 6, 7
- Endovascular embolization is effective in >90% of cases and preserves maximal renal parenchyma by targeting only the affected vessel 2, 3, 6
- Access via common femoral artery (or brachial artery if femoral access fails) with selective catheterization of the affected renal artery branch 3
- Deploy microcoils (MicroNester, MReye, or equivalent) sized appropriately based on vessel diameter determined at angiography 3
- Completion angiography must confirm complete pseudoaneurysm exclusion 3
Emergency Surgical Repair Indications
Proceed directly to open surgical repair when: 6, 7
- Hemodynamic instability with active hemorrhage 2
- Failed or impossible endovascular access (inability to catheterize the feeding vessel) 2
- Rupture with retroperitoneal hematoma expansion 7
Conservative Management is NOT Recommended
- Although some renal pseudoaneurysms may spontaneously regress, observation alone carries unacceptable rupture risk and is contraindicated in the vast majority of patients 7
- The unpredictability of spontaneous resolution versus life-threatening rupture makes expectant management inappropriate 7
Step 3: Post-Intervention Monitoring
- Hematuria (gross or microscopic) should resolve within days after successful embolization 3, 4
- Persistent or recurrent hematuria mandates repeat imaging to assess for incomplete embolization or new pseudoaneurysm formation 2, 4
- Follow-up imaging at 1 month is reasonable to confirm pseudoaneurysm thrombosis and assess for delayed complications 6
Critical Pitfalls to Avoid
- Do not delay intervention while attempting conservative management—renal artery pseudoaneurysms are unstable lesions with high rupture potential 7
- Do not rely on clinical presentation alone—pseudoaneurysms may present acutely or years after initial injury with a wide spectrum of symptoms from asymptomatic to life-threatening hemorrhage 2, 7
- Do not assume small size equals low risk—even small pseudoaneurysms can rupture catastrophically 7
- Do not continue smoking—ongoing tobacco use will accelerate pseudoaneurysm growth and increase rupture risk 1
Hypertension Management
- Aggressively control blood pressure to reduce wall stress on the pseudoaneurysm and prevent rupture 1
- Target blood pressure should follow guidelines for patients with peripheral arterial disease (typically <140/90 mmHg, or <130/80 mmHg if tolerated) 1
- ACE inhibitors or ARBs are appropriate first-line agents for blood pressure control in patients with renal vascular disease 1
